NTA CSIR UGC NET June Online Form 2026

National Testing Agency (NTA) announced the NTA CSIR UGC NET June Online Form 2026 with various vacancies including Junior Research Fellowship and Lectureship. Aspiring candidates can now apply online, with the application process open for the year 2026.

Submit applications by 19 June 2026. The age limits follow NTA rules, and the application fee for the General category is ₹ 1150/-. Begin by visiting the official website to register using your necessary credentials.

Age Limit

CriteriaAge Limit
For JRFMaximum Age : 30 Year
For NETNo Age Limit

Additional Age Relaxation as per UGC CSIR NET June 2026 Examination Guidelines

CourseEligibility
UGC CSIR NET June Examination 2026
  • CSIR UGC NET 2026, candidates with an M.Sc. or equivalent degree need 55% marks (50% for SC/ST). Those with B.E./B.Tech, B.Pharma, MBBS, or integrated courses are also eligible.
